Steps to find the percentage of a number

Method 1: Using Proportions

Let's find 56% of 702.2 using proportion.

56% is 56 out of 100.

\[ \frac{ 56 }{100} \]

Write the proportion to find x out of 702.2.

\[ \frac{ 56 }{100} = \frac{x}{ 702.2 } \]

Cross-multiply: 56 × 702.2 = 100x

\[ 56 \cdot 702.2 = 100x \]

Solve for x: (56 × 702.2) ÷ 100 = x

\[ \frac{ 39323.2 }{100} = x \]

Hence, 56% of 702.2 is 393.232.

Method 2: Keyword-Based

Use keywords: "of" means multiply.

Convert 56% to decimal: 0.56

\[ x = 702.2 \cdot 0.56 \]

Multiply 702.2 × 0.56 = 393.232

So, 56% of 702.2 is 393.232.

Method 3: Formula-Based

Use the formula: percent × whole = part

Convert 56% to decimal: 0.56

\[ \text{Percentage} \cdot \text{Whole} = \text{Part} \]

702.2 × 0.56 = 393.232

Thus, 56% of 702.2 is 393.232.
